Seeking to rectify an embarrassing and expensive mistake, the Arizona legislature met in special session in October to call to a halt an alternative-fuel tax-incentive program it had approved only five months earlier.

The city council elections are over, and now, as chief of staff to Mayor Jamie Wiliams, you need to turn your attention to the next two years--the last two years. The city charter prohibits the mayor of Zenith City from seeking a third four-year term. Yet Mayor Wiliams has to govern for two more years--during which time everyone will call her (although not always to her face) a lame duck.
